Adaptive Double Plateaus Histogram Equalization

Description

compute the paramters, t_down and t_up, and then apply double plateaus histogram equalization.

Usage

EqualizeADP(im, n = 5, N = 1000, range = c(0, 255),
  returnparam = FALSE)

Arguments

im

a grayscale image of class cimg

n

window size to determine local maximum

N

the number of subintervals of histogram

range

range of the pixel values of image. this function assumes that the range of pixel values of of an input image is [0,255] by default. you may prefer [0,1].

returnparam

if returnparam is TRUE, returns the computed parameters: t_down and t_up.

Value

a grayscale image of class cimg or a numericvector
